Rob Bacher wrote: > > And, if I don't get SIGSEGV errors, I get vars being randomly changed. I > trace through the program line by line and watch and variables change > for no reason. The more reasonable couse of your problem is writing to memory which not allocated at all or writing behind allocated bouds. I have EXACTLY the same problem with some of my programms and the reason was as I mentioned above. To keep my programm out of such things I always use Fortify at developing stage.
